Mammogram Images: Normal & Abnormal

Mammograms look for abnormalities that can suggest breast cancer, explains Dr. Monica Suarez Kobilis, Family Medicine Physician with Baptist Health Primary Care. Radiologists are the physicians who read mammograms. They also can suggest if the person needs a mammogram sooner than a year. Taking some pain relievers, such as Tylenol or Motrin, before mammogram and using ice packs after it can be helped with the discomfort that tests can cause, the expert says.
